CBS’ firefighting drama “Fire Country” turns this up in Season 3, with returning stars and some newcomers joining the crew.

The series, inspired by star Max Thieriot’s experiences growing up in Northern California’s fire country, kicks off Season 3 on the day of Gabriela Perez (Stephanie Arcila) and Diego (Rafael de la Fuente)’s wedding. When a fire breaks out and threatens the lives of the people in the area, the team springs into action to extinguish the flames.

When will season 3 of “Fire Country” be released?

Season 3 of “Fire Country” debuts Friday, October 18 on CBS at 9 PM EST/PST.

Where is ‘Fire Country’ streaming?

Season 3 of “Fire Country” will stream exclusively on Paramount+. New episodes of the firefighter drama will appear on the platform the day after it airs on CBS on Fridays.

If viewers have a Paramount+ subscription, bundled with Showtime, they can stream the show live along with the network broadcast.

Seasons 1 and 2 of “Fire Country” are also currently streaming on Paramount+.

What is ‘Fireland’ about?

Here’s CBS’ official description of “Fire Country”: “Fire Country” stars Max Thieriot (“Seal Team”) as Bode Leone, a young convict seeking redemption and a shortened prison sentence by participating in a firefighting program for release from prisons in Northern California, where he and other inmates work alongside elite firefighters to extinguish massive, unpredictable wildfires in the region. It’s a high-risk, high-reward assignment, and the tension mounts when Bode is assigned to the program in his rural hometown, where he was once a golden, all-American son until his troubles began. Years ago, Bode burned everything in his life and left town with a big secret. Now he’s back, with the rap sheet of a criminal and the nerve to believe in a chance at redemption at Cal Fire.

Who’s in the cast of ‘Fire Country’?

The main cast of “Fire Country” includes Max Thieriot, Billy Burke, Kevin Alejandro, Diane Farr, Stephanie Arcila, Jordan Calloway and Jules Latimer. Newcomers include Jared Padalecki and Leven Rambin.
